The history of blind slats can be traced back to ancient Persia, where they were originally made from bamboo. Over time, blind slats have evolved to include a wide range of materials such as wood, aluminum, and PVC. Today, blind slats are available in a variety of colors, sizes, and finishes to suit any decor style.

One of the greatest advantages of blind slats is their versatility. They can be adjusted to control the amount of light entering a room, making them an ideal choice for bedrooms, living rooms, and offices. By simply tilting the slats, you can easily regulate the brightness in a room to create the perfect ambiance.

Privacy is another key benefit of blind slats. By adjusting the angle of the slats, you can block the view into your home without sacrificing natural light. This is particularly important for ground-floor windows or rooms facing busy streets. blind slats allow you to enjoy the view outside while maintaining your privacy.

In addition to light and privacy control, blind slats also offer excellent airflow regulation. By tilting the slats slightly, you can let fresh air flow into a room while still maintaining some degree of privacy. This is particularly useful during the warmer months when you want to keep your home cool and comfortable.

When it comes to installation, blind slats are relatively easy to mount and can be customized to fit any window size. Whether you prefer a traditional corded system or a modern motorized option, there are blind slats available to suit your needs. Many manufacturers offer professional installation services to ensure that your blind slats are properly installed and functioning correctly.

Maintenance of blind slats is also straightforward. Regular dusting and occasional cleaning with a damp cloth are usually all that is required to keep your blind slats looking like new. In the case of any damage or wear and tear, individual slats can be easily replaced without having to replace the entire blind system.
